What Can I Do To Lower My SGOT/SGPT Levels?

Hello. I am 33 years old, 5'3" 144 lbs. I took LFT two weeks ago and my SGOT level was 98 and SGPT level was at 58, both high. I do have high tolerance for alcohol and really am trying to lower my alcohol intake. What else can I do to lower my SGOT/SGPT levels and how long would it take for them to get in the normal range.

General Surgeon 's  Response
hi.

noted history of high levels of liver enzymes and chronic alcoholism. decreasing will help but avoidance of alcohol intake is best. also, do not take medications or supplements which are not FDA recommended or if you have no indication for it. it is best if you consult with a doctor, for clinical evaluation and management.

hope this helps.
